PARTNERSHIP WITH HORSES meeting held at FENCE

Ray Hunt, master of true horsemanship through feel said “I'm here for the horse - to help him get a better deal". With this same philosophy, Partnership with Horses was organized with the mission to promote the physical and mental well being of horses by honoring their natural beauty and expression.

The goals of Partnership with Horses is to network; support local instructors, veterinarians, horsemanship clinics and riding events; and share information on how to develop a mutual respect with horses through understanding, listening, and communicating using the least amount of interference, forced submission, or fear.

 Partnership with Horses is a group of people who are involved in various riding styles getting together to learn about the natural way of horses to improve our relationships, riding skills, safety, and care of them.  All methods of “natural horsemanship” are welcomed.  Topics and/or demonstrations focus on approaching the horse on their terms.  Meetings consist of a guest speaker and time to network beforehand.  The cost is a minimum of a $10 donation to the equine related organization of the guest speaker’s choice. We meet every second Tuesday of the month.
